Dry skin can be a challenge at times no matter your age group. Your skin may become flaky and at other times red and irritated or worse both at the same time.
What is dry skin caused by? Dry skin results from a lack of sebum or oil production. Sebum is made within your skin cells and it's vital for having healthy, elastic glowing skin. Dry skin can be caused by your age and your background.
Do you have any of these skin type characteristics?
1 ~Skin always burns in the sun.
2~Your mom has dry skin.
3~Even texture, flat finish, your skin may look flaky and dull.
4~Skin feels dry and chapped but blemish free.
5~Pores are very small.
Those are just a few signs that you have dry skin.
Dry skin needs a replacement of the natural oils which are best done, from the inside and on the outside.
Start by looking at your moisturizers, does your skin seem to drink it up? Then it's possible you need to add a serum as well to your skincare routine. Does your face feel tight after less than a hour after applying your skin cream? You may not be applying the best one for your dry skin issues.
Inside treatment could mean taking a hard look at your diet, if you are a smoker, under lots of stress. All these factors can add up to making your skin look dull and unhealthy.
Your skin is the largest organ of your body and needs to be nourished just like every other body part. Start by drinking more water, and making sure you are feeding your skin the best supplements including Omega-3 oils, vitamin E, and a complex B vitamin. If you aren't sure you are getting enough through what you are eating, a natural foods store will offer these supplements and others to help you nourish your skin from the inside out.
Nourishing your dry skin both inside and out is the best approach to healing. Talk with your dermatologist before any major changes to your skincare.
